The Echocardiographic Assessment of Left Ventricular Function and Dimensionsults without proper validation. Traditionally, fractional shortening and ejection fraction have been used to evaluate systolic function, but they have limitations in patients with congenital heart disease. Newer methods show promise, but pediatric experience is limited. Most functional indices were
